Summer.fi, a DeFi yield-optimization platform formerly known as Oasis.app that spun out of the Maker Foundation in 2021, operated the DAO-governed Lazy Summer Protocol until a July 6, 2026 exploit drained roughly $6.04 million from two of its USDC vaults via a flash-loan-funded share-price manipulation of the Fleet Commander accounting contract. Summer.fi's own post-mortem attributes the loss to an operational oversight — an old, capped strategy that was never fully removed from vault net-asset-value calculations — rather than a smart-contract bug or compromised keys. The Summer.fi Labs company announced on July 15, 2026 that it would wind down and shut off its app by August 31, 2026, leaving user compensation and the fate of roughly $4 million in illiquid affected-vault holdings to a future Lazy Summer DAO governance vote.

Timeline(8 events)
June 2021
Oasis.app (later Summer.fi) spins out as an independent entity following the decentralization of the Maker Foundation.
Summer.fi official blogJune 2023
Oasis.app rebrands to Summer.fi, expanding beyond its Maker-centric roots into a multi-protocol yield platform.
Summer.fi official blog6 April 2026
Attacker allegedly begins funding multiple wallets used later in the exploit, according to Summer.fi's post-mortem on-chain analysis.
Summer.fi post-mortem blog6 July 2026
At approximately 05:17 UTC, an attacker executes a single atomic transaction using a ~$65.4M flash loan to manipulate Fleet Commander vault share pricing, redeeming ~$70.9M against ~$64.8M deposited and netting roughly $6.04M in stolen USDC across two vaults.
Summer.fi post-mortem blog / The Block6 July 2026
Blockaid flags the exploit at approximately 05:36 UTC; Summer.fi zeroes deposit caps by 06:42 UTC and pauses Ethereum/Base vaults by 10:25 UTC, then Arbitrum/Sonic vaults by 11:38 UTC.
Summer.fi post-mortem blog6 July 2026
News outlets including CoinDesk and The Block report the exploit and Summer.fi's vault pause.
CoinDesk / The Block15 July 2026
Summer.fi Labs announces it will wind down the company and shut off the Summer.fi app by August 31, 2026, citing the exploit's financial impact.
Summer.fi official blog31 August 2026
Planned date for the Summer.fi application and support channels to cease operating.
